Description
Transform your home studio into a professional recording environment with the Focusrite Scarlett 2i2 Studio (3rd gen). This all-in-one bundle is perfect for budding musicians and seasoned producers alike, offering everything you need to capture high-quality audio with ease. At its heart, the Scarlett 2i2 features award-winning Focusrite preamps, renowned for their transparent, low-noise performance and dynamic range. Whether you’re recording vocals, guitars, or synths, these preamps ensure every detail is captured with pristine clarity.
The Scarlett 2i2 Studio bundle goes beyond just an interface. Included is the CM25 condenser microphone, known for its smooth, detailed sound, and the HP60 closed-back headphones, offering accurate monitoring and isolation. The combination makes it easy to achieve professional-grade recordings without stepping outside your creative space.
Software is never an afterthought with Focusrite. The bundle includes an extensive suite of production tools, such as Ableton Live Lite and the Focusrite Red Plug-in Suite, enabling you to sculpt your sound with precision. Intuitive halo indicators on the interface provide visual feedback to keep your levels in check, ensuring your sessions remain distortion-free.
Whether you're recording at home or on the go, the Scarlett 2i2's USB bus power and compact design mean you're always ready to capture inspiration when it strikes.
Key Features:
- Two high-performance Focusrite mic/line/instrument preamps
- CM25 condenser microphone and HP60 headphones included
- 24-bit/192kHz converters for clear sound quality
- Direct monitoring with zero latency
- USB bus-powered for portability
- Comprehensive software bundle with Ableton Live Lite and Focusrite Red Plug-in Suite

FAQs
-
What are the main connectivity options for the Focusrite Scarlett 2i2 Studio (3rd Gen)?
-
The Focusrite Scarlett 2i2 Studio (3rd Gen) features two XLR/TRS combo inputs, two balanced 1/4” line outputs, and a USB-C port for computer connectivity, making it versatile for various recording setups.
-
Is the Focusrite Scarlett 2i2 Studio (3rd Gen) compatible with major DAWs like Ableton Live and Pro Tools?
-
Yes, the Scarlett 2i2 Studio (3rd Gen) is compatible with all major DAWs, including Ableton Live and Pro Tools, ensuring seamless integration into your recording workflow.
-
What makes the 3rd generation Focusrite Scarlett 2i2 different from earlier versions?
-
The 3rd generation Scarlett 2i2 includes the Air Circuit for enhanced high-frequency detail and a Mono/Stereo selector for monitoring, along with balanced 1/4” line outputs for improved connectivity to monitors.
-
Can the Focusrite Scarlett 2i2 Studio (3rd Gen) be used for recording vocals and instruments simultaneously?
-
Yes, the Scarlett 2i2 Studio (3rd Gen) allows for simultaneous recording of vocals and instruments with its two combo inputs, making it ideal for singer-songwriters and small bands.
-
What is included in the Focusrite Scarlett 2i2 Studio (3rd Gen) bundle?
-
The Scarlett 2i2 Studio (3rd Gen) bundle includes the Scarlett 2i2 audio interface, a CM25 MkIII condenser microphone, HP60 MkIII closed-back headphones, and all necessary cables, providing a complete recording solution.

Owner Insights
We analyzed real musician discussions from forums and Reddit to find what players love, question, and tweak about Focusrite Scarlett 2i2 Studio (3rd gen).
User experience
-
Some owners report crackling issues when adjusting the volume knob due to dust accumulation over time.
Source -
An issue with the low frequencies causing crackling has been mentioned, potentially affecting bass-heavy music.
Source -
The 2i2 is preferred over the Solo for its capacity to handle stereo recordings, accommodating diverse audio sources like synthesizers and ensuring broader application versatility.
Source
Comparisons
-
The Audient ID4 is noted for its durability and metal build, contrasting with the Scarlett's plastic feel.
Source -
The MOTU M2 is highlighted for superior input/output options and a front panel display, offering a potential upgrade path.
Source -
The 4i4 offers additional line inputs/outputs but shares core functionality with the 2i2, suggesting the latter is sufficient for most basic recording needs.
Source -
The Behringer UMC 204HD is recommended over the Scarlett Solo for those needing additional outputs, as it offers long-term benefits despite a small price difference.
Source -
The MOTU M2 is noted for superior sound quality and a more noticeable improvement over the Focusrite Scarlett, making headphone listening more enjoyable despite its higher cost.
Source
Mods and upgrades
-
Cleaning the volume knob to prevent crackling is possible but risky, with tutorials available online.
Source
Features and functionality
-
The 2i2 is praised for its low latency transmission, making it ideal for real-time monitoring during recording sessions.
Source -
The Scarlett Solo 4th Gen now includes an independent headphone output with its own level control, which is a significant upgrade from earlier generations.
Source -
The Scarlett 2i2 allows recording of vocals and guitar simultaneously, which is advantageous over the Solo for users who plan to record both at the same time.
Source
Use cases and applications
-
Suitable for guitar and bass recording, pending the use of instruments with appropriate output levels to avoid potential issues.
Source -
The ability to record stereo signals is highlighted as crucial for future-proofing, allowing for more versatile recording setups, such as sampling from phones or synthesizers.
Source
